Transaction 192979499f44ed85070ea1dca06d3e19c2db6cc1f77a3990f7fa891e11b4e98e

41 Input
2 Outputs
  • 192979499f44ed85070ea1dca06d3e19c2db6cc1f77a3990f7fa891e11b4e98e:0
  • value  6011173185
    address  1LhWMukxP6QGhW6TMEZRcqEUW2bFMA4Rwx
  • 192979499f44ed85070ea1dca06d3e19c2db6cc1f77a3990f7fa891e11b4e98e:1
  • value  987082
    address  15k6bPWHpVEbKfiuwW9JJYXAS8pzTt71mW